Toyota Mirai Customer Order Request Portal is Up and Running for Californians

As announced last week, Toyota launched the customer order platform for the Toyota Mirai fuel cell EV, which means future clients can start filling out the form and wait for Toyota's approval.
Remember, only those living in California will be able to get the Mirai, but we'll stop here from twisting the knife even further.

You also might remember that Toyota decided to give the Mirai a limited production run (3,000 units through 2017), which means their standards for approving customer orders are likely to be pretty high.

After placing a request, potential Mirai drivers will be contacted directly by a Toyota representative to discuss ownership and next steps if the carmaker considers they are fit to own a Mirai.

Even so, clients will have to wait for their car around three months because the Mirai will reach dealerships in October. Also, it's not wearing as small price tag by any means: Toyota set a $57,500 MSRP sticker for the fuel cell EV, without including the $835 destination fee.

However, the 2016 Toyota Mirai will also offer some benefits to those lucky enough to own one.

For example, drivers will be provided with three years’ worth of complimentary fuel (or $15,000 maximum, whichever comes first), complimentary Safety Connect and Entune, including hydrogen station finder app, and free scheduled maintenance for three years, or 35,000 miles, whichever comes first.

A batch of cars has already been shipped to the US, but you also need to know Toyota Mirai has an EPA-estimated driving range rating of 312 miles (502 km) on a single fill of hydrogen.
